CHICO, Calif. – Lawrence Walls, 73, died at 9:07 p.m. Aug. 18, 2013, at his home in Chico, Calif.
He was born Feb. 5, 1940, in Warsaw to John Perry and Lula Spradlin Walls. On May 1, 1965, in Germany, he married Betal (Susie) Krezicha, who survives.
He attended Pierceton High School. He was a 22-year career Army officer, serving two tours in Vietnam. After retiring from service, he returned to Warsaw and worked for the U.S. Postal Service. He moved to Paradise, Calif., and worked for the U.S. Postal Service there for 15 years, retiring due to ill health.
He and his wife traveled extensively. He had a great interest in photography, flowers, genealogy and collecting service medals. He loved spending time with his grandchildren.
Also surviving are a son, Dirk (and friend Dorothea) Walls; daughter, Michele (and spouse Dr. Gabriel) Pereira; two granddaughters; a brother, Douglas (and spouse Nancy) Walls, Pierceton; sisters, Irene (and spouse Norman) Clay, Warsaw; Alice (and spouse Luke) Lockwood, Pierceton; sister-in-law Becky Walls, Pierceton; and step-father John King, Port Charlotte, Fla.
He was preceded in death by his parents and two brothers, Steven and Lee Walls.
Services were held Saturday in the St. Thomas More Catholic Church, Paradise, with a military service.
